Ravendarksky

#19
All I have to add to this really is that measuring peoples top performance doesn't really give you an indication of how consistent they are which is IMO much more important.

Sure on a good day I can hold my own against many people here... but on an average day I'd get wiped across the floor. My performances are very inconsistent.

I don't think it would be a workable system but basically an average of 10 games would give a much better indication of skill. I don't see any problem with this since we are working based on a system of trust anyway so there is no need for judging.

I'm not sure if I'd want to make that 10 games of dig challenge or 20. How separate are you wanting to treat scoring and survival length?

jkwon23

#21
Dig challenge's garbage rise speed increases exponentially. That means player has to be much better at downstack to pass on to the next level.

I think cheese mode (longer dig mode) indicates downstack skill  more precisely.
